Structural determination of neptunium redox species in aqueous solutions

Ikeda, Atsushi; Hennig, C.*; Rossberg, A.*; Funke, H.*; Scheinost, A. C.*; Bernhard, G.*; Yaita, Tsuyoshi

ESRF Highlights 2008, p.99 - 100, 2009/02

Structural arrangement of Np species has been investigated in various aqueous solutions by synchrotron-based X-ray absorption fine structure (XAFS) spectroscopy. The obtained results revealed that Np(IV) dominantly forms a spherically coordinated decahydrate complex, [Np(H$$_{2}$$O)$$_{20}$$]$$^{4+}$$, while Np(V) and -(VI) form a pentahydrate neptunyl complex, [NpO$$_{2}$$(H$$_{2}$$O)$$_{5}$$]$$^{n+}$$.
